From mboxrd@z Thu Jan  1 00:00:00 1970
Return-Path: <dev-bounces@dpdk.org>
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124])
	by inbox.dpdk.org (Postfix) with ESMTP id 40582A0547;
	Sun, 18 Apr 2021 21:20:21 +0200 (CEST)
Received: from [217.70.189.124] (localhost [127.0.0.1])
	by mails.dpdk.org (Postfix) with ESMTP id 0A05B41108;
	Sun, 18 Apr 2021 21:20:21 +0200 (CEST)
Received: from NAM12-BN8-obe.outbound.protection.outlook.com
 (mail-bn8nam12on2057.outbound.protection.outlook.com [40.107.237.57])
 by mails.dpdk.org (Postfix) with ESMTP id 51942410D7
 for <dev@dpdk.org>; Sun, 18 Apr 2021 21:20:20 +0200 (CEST)
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none;
 b=YdL3ujYHAiSDadwm4RY8MPesremqFAzHp3tTvRvGlYmZwguBr0ihtOtqORyOgezEt+XIv17Iu8DT16js2E3xINBqQJGVFMKp/EdJWUWqOYjsf1uU9XyWtvC5kGXC1f/y97CazZ16u/eUwtzo48l0mS7j/FjUgj9r0umwJVEqeY44p/Q6o/Eh9zk5pSk/B87HU0lxDFDvK9EN+wnh9QvL7GWtqq96q3jyZH6gAHF7bP3KeTDW2CFNoRCxPMrKdVkjAmwASNE0BOfztGnp8ULfxoiR+ksnO5SOgWTsWdxwhtsFUim2iaHxpfyntRhHaalYjf+M+mnr5wr1Bh6EmBlGhA==
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; 
 s=arcselector9901;
 h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ck;
 bh=HIV8WFQxBvct90QNCBCyAAd4dXfejj/cdeNRw8ErwxQ=;
 b=F1L79dE4GBHOtmEGOQTljzSZGfO1xDmH43tu1YY+mCU8S4e14wn+bdXCwhXEqpD2urnVfStML4Lym6SfE1G9UDPi8tAUVFFGAxl1AYRB5eXaKRu6SJxkxuE5Z5BQA0l9LwOlsE19g0LyfSC9WWJbQfTWgEJpM5nzgi8QTcvx3AJBIanVwjCxxN5jvvX7EpPKo6IshwyB+MnUYxl3+YC2v29RiVpvHJ1qOCGHDKqXCbTStX0D9q7m0Z5LT4NjjtV/EG8HQllKI7zqSw8Vg/ICw8cEJBp2QcN7BogSk8rqa3l9a+xJ7jazgPggirgOjbdTJEa9Ui/a8QdL7v43dd+vsQ==
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ass
 smtp.mailfrom=nvidia.com; dmarc=pass action=none header.from=nvidia.com;
 dkim=pass header.d=nvidia.com; arc=none
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Nvidia.com;
 s=selector2;
 h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ck;
 bh=HIV8WFQxBvct90QNCBCyAAd4dXfejj/cdeNRw8ErwxQ=;
 b=SxuMG03TbwC9AsPknJjwINvkSG9u3PZ5uD5D+JHMfR/p2C4K6gBXFORLQRk+8U8jOSd8ZSVAPArBl39SQhw5U3vq/DiFORGBxfNqcO4waYVlBswn2sOmCGBMZS9IBWZZiaXueha4XyKxArXckSlvQrjtnem7ub3PUQiblTHPI4Td79YbUjTGf4qXqSgaujeUMeg2EyxqSiWN6eSgeLkg6sblBFNIYQn5rRTaniymDGBHlzTHsSD6YMaPTOWIKqo10MzR2JIMTlqcImmnmd4/djBSehQ7c1Kplm4R6pt+2qRJcmtdIR+QYCueZIHf8DyOKBELNSJxEPW8QV7vgkkI9A==
Received: from DM6PR12MB3945.namprd12.prod.outlook.com (2603:10b6:5:1c2::27)
 by DM6PR12MB4986.namprd12.prod.outlook.com (2603:10b6:5:16f::13) with
 Microsoft SMTP Server (version=TLS1_2,
 c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4042.21; Sun, 18 Apr
 2021 19:20:18 +0000
Received: from DM6PR12MB3945.namprd12.prod.outlook.com
 ([fe80::9d62:2f16:264b:285d]) by DM6PR12MB3945.namprd12.prod.outlook.com
 ([fe80::9d62:2f16:264b:285d%5]) with mapi id 15.20.4042.024; Sun, 18 Apr 2021
 19:20:18 +0000
From: Tal Shnaiderman <talshn@nvidia.com>
To: Tal Shnaiderman <talshn@nvidia.com>, NBU-Contact-Thomas Monjalon
 <thomas@monjalon.net>, Jie Zhou <jizh@linux.microsoft.com>, "dev@dpdk.org"
 <dev@dpdk.org>
CC: "dmitry.kozliuk@gmail.com" <dmitry.kozliuk@gmail.com>,
 "xiaoyun.li@intel.com" <xiaoyun.li@intel.com>, "roretzla@microsoft.com"
 <roretzla@microsoft.com>, "pallavi.kadam@intel.com"
 <pallavi.kadam@intel.com>, "bruce.richardson@intel.com"
 <bruce.richardson@intel.com>, "ferruh.yigit@intel.com"
 <ferruh.yigit@intel.com>
Thread-Topic: [dpdk-dev] [PATCH v5 9/9] app/testpmd: enable building testpmd
 on Windows
Thread-Index: AQHXMuonME9uJJ5tZE+gEge7QHUjKqq6fdDAgAAaroCAAA0p8IAAA4mA
Date: Sun, 18 Apr 2021 19:20:18 +0000
Message-ID: <DM6PR12MB39451985FA1C5C4ADFCEBFEAA44A9@DM6PR12MB3945.namprd12.prod.outlook.com>
References: <1618594501-23795-10-git-send-email-jizh@linux.microsoft.com>
 <1618595864-27839-10-git-send-email-jizh@linux.microsoft.com>
 <DM6PR12MB39456139D8044AED5BC4D8C6A44A9@DM6PR12MB3945.namprd12.prod.outlook.com>
 <1637838.CI588iCA6l@thomas>
 <DM6PR12MB3945E1AE4EFBE61F0D0094E1A44A9@DM6PR12MB3945.namprd12.prod.outlook.com>
In-Reply-To: <DM6PR12MB3945E1AE4EFBE61F0D0094E1A44A9@DM6PR12MB3945.namprd12.prod.outlook.com>
Accept-Language: en-US
Content-Language: en-US
X-MS-Has-Attach: 
X-MS-TNEF-Correlator: 
authentication-results: nvidia.com; dkim=none (message not signed)
 header.d=none;nvidia.com; dmarc=none action=none header.from=nvidia.com;
x-originating-ip: [5.29.61.36]
x-ms-publictraffictype: Email
x-ms-office365-filtering-correlation-id: b4890cb2-bcaf-49a4-98f8-08d9029f00ee
x-ms-traffictypediagnostic: DM6PR12MB4986:
x-ld-processed: 43083d15-7273-40c1-b7db-39efd9ccc17a,ExtAddr
x-ms-exchange-transport-forked: True
x-microsoft-antispam-prvs: <DM6PR12MB4986639AF744CA035A29BFB8A44A9@DM6PR12MB4986.namprd12.prod.outlook.com>
x-ms-oob-tlc-oobclassifiers: OLM:7219;
x-ms-exchange-senderadcheck: 1
x-microsoft-antispam: BCL:0;
x-microsoft-antispam-message-info: auUfecqrsvr1HzbalBmI8mY/jiqBDmr7AyBzyVNGWCJW+VquzITjDcA/jegrO6noHtWLgGsngFO5SW9FxNSAfS4dtnD/2qrmcO/VCqaf/QHfS+u8sJ+eB0KqENBpmHIhBy1dznwacc0iZqs52VyD0dMzBd6Y4mbD2v8r1nrLvVM9kR+KXJ1ILo13IF3ffThGhnjhVkg2uc/WVauVIU2qjkelGPZM2N7ZAUOtmyUgdUxb3v3HWT8eEtpjx+cgL6mQ8JHnYzA5mPYcqZAO6RJUilSOnGGSyhgPy9ZW+6eXWXnuoyHg//L2yp5L6fqaNE/H5M24LXBekTOkCEI43Sav8WKNLLpS+ThjIn3IyxmcQuQsKCIDtM8in3ZiOotNH4YHc658FVk+KS09zsyYOQe8JuXJ29uhE7Kn6fly3MUiDTvpTq4eEyY8/0q6RoOvfaj15yaYFt4tA8gTohgqbZ6xBkhp5XjtNoCBJg103scUG1E4inW7shXY2K25wACx5ronT3KbyMaYct3zh8heert8jyj6Ce5kye3mJZBnVShIJfUteX9pbXbvF2QAh7qtXut1uRHL5dnl7NlTyRSx0Or8ayv0ngA0LinsEL6R7gtS1UIOGuPP1ahhmKeesApMnuGZ7+QbgtRqo1AwE9tvRZUTinvZe6LkTaDJpiAqYRi58tWUrjaopJVFPdQ4+DpxkTCN
x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:;
 IPV:NLI; SFV:NSPM; H:DM6PR12MB3945.namprd12.prod.outlook.com; PTR:; CAT:NONE;
 SFS:(4636009)(39860400002)(136003)(396003)(366004)(376002)(346002)(83380400001)(76116006)(316002)(8936002)(52536014)(4326008)(33656002)(8676002)(26005)(186003)(66446008)(66556008)(64756008)(66946007)(86362001)(66476007)(9686003)(2940100002)(55016002)(122000001)(7696005)(110136005)(966005)(54906003)(478600001)(2906002)(6506007)(71200400001)(5660300002)(38100700002);
 DIR:OUT; SFP:1101; 
x-ms-exchange-antispam-messagedata: =?us-ascii?Q?DxqrnSoB5oI3Fsy8AI7ClOSXR2EeESSwYEboTON96LzQncDmP4GuPcZA0Ziz?=
 =?us-ascii?Q?l210oygofl5le9p7E30lO95VnOmsiQ3ZpI1/kExDcyVIlNK3Swty1bhN51UT?=
 =?us-ascii?Q?wecflxWRUeppKVOgff1lHWentYML4JcRAxyANctmFltqv0eVOOCPSUitClPy?=
 =?us-ascii?Q?ctdgKFA2B7hEZ1y7FfAjg1PnBbHmGGx/1G/BEF/VJ0lmTWpmYoMdZFxE/iA+?=
 =?us-ascii?Q?1u8IHTG8tywEw46n/3qHHgv9jewhwTfkOwJCDeei2XsgmgzVlIpNIgI/J/2F?=
 =?us-ascii?Q?71oVIjPJDMeRRQg6ycm+7fbohliQ8uJznhpjbd7a0+2dNrTq4wU0GDkJ6e2b?=
 =?us-ascii?Q?4TUAJu7ifU9q9pdDgAUk73szInBkw7LpQRb2NLBN27KEOfgD6rumpRqvoTMs?=
 =?us-ascii?Q?9A4y4zNGSKbsmUEH+cq1ziqN/aeJ+OS8UZs+aiwCUB7PmmzS4V9bL/gZ2l9c?=
 =?us-ascii?Q?81zxXtJ61lOLbvXfAcRnltQ3d0I9qXDBHMDEYncDNB3ou0QNmKeLxKFYbUDF?=
 =?us-ascii?Q?dqwix69ZeGGyomEBjLmMlHMvuT/Q2AvYr+51meM6VneV8rBTr6BCPDCOFyde?=
 =?us-ascii?Q?1GTqTRjz3vF/YfYiJzOlo0iTWLQUj0CGhkkIuKIzZhM3CuN2D6rqJxlZoP11?=
 =?us-ascii?Q?76Jfjg3fla0DaxFOKa6TLrcXNLMdPhDKdPoKLqJ202Fnu4ObY6913K8kkCyj?=
 =?us-ascii?Q?l7R/fL17xNpBdACobDpKVtXnM8FKFiYhhj6jn9K56abuV5w5LPLu8W8qGvIU?=
 =?us-ascii?Q?otlzZqt3eJK2q4cZbyKRSge6L+iej5Thf631MK0JIzz36o5I93rM7lr75osk?=
 =?us-ascii?Q?tq3vL1aWiCd38kiQLhxKtTVlpjx1HWIQvea6U0VEBnFoLkc08sOecXX/PaQa?=
 =?us-ascii?Q?NbMueZngmEdaAOh5V3JQMlr1OghO0NXRnk8AH1/da7aL4IYXWE1djwW3Gqcb?=
 =?us-ascii?Q?BNqcxCZZcP/pb931QaIfuN7RawL/A4SEtYkvE+546aiHzcxxsiv4NDQx6rtt?=
 =?us-ascii?Q?kxvGtuE0RqbCLHPBQx5q+qIZdBPx9SNJLyIfQHhww9qhF3VRX7kMRnwdCySR?=
 =?us-ascii?Q?QSuctkxhfajpyPVZmmNCP5yWn79Z6p99PGE5DbffZS+dVWgRKa9kJHgc/d2c?=
 =?us-ascii?Q?uWLG0NBMWRyOmh8rOJspNcyS1B0CCB7czBY/vOYqP76GKPIekrrv5PgLcKo6?=
 =?us-ascii?Q?FhpEoyx8XrkAmRlGgpm9hI6Ynw3h/whXjxyX7snVrTDNdt29Cj9rZ/iMOKXY?=
 =?us-ascii?Q?fzUfuT15F1kOarp0fAsPofWNr7kgZMGrhUqAbZWyFXe0GeQlY7Kl9yXZ/AxE?=
 =?us-ascii?Q?4t4=3D?=
Content-Type: text/plain; charset="us-ascii"
Content-Transfer-Encoding: quoted-printable
MIME-Version: 1.0
X-OriginatorOrg: Nvidia.com
X-MS-Exchange-CrossTenant-AuthAs: Internal
X-MS-Exchange-CrossTenant-AuthSource: DM6PR12MB3945.namprd12.prod.outlook.com
X-MS-Exchange-CrossTenant-Network-Message-Id: b4890cb2-bcaf-49a4-98f8-08d9029f00ee
X-MS-Exchange-CrossTenant-originalarrivaltime: 18 Apr 2021 19:20:18.7108 (UTC)
X-MS-Exchange-CrossTenant-fromentityheader: Hosted
X-MS-Exchange-CrossTenant-id: 43083d15-7273-40c1-b7db-39efd9ccc17a
X-MS-Exchange-CrossTenant-mailboxtype: HOSTED
X-MS-Exchange-CrossTenant-userprincipalname: xc/BYxjtvtDvQ2zgChNtnO9dd22zXwJv/3R4VLoxpa4lLEhEGuruUuDgznFxYm9kXuGn6oJyn4klITuHEWe0+Q==
X-MS-Exchange-Transport-CrossTenantHeadersStamped: DM6PR12MB4986
Subject: Re: [dpdk-dev] [PATCH v5 9/9] app/testpmd: enable building testpmd
 on Windows
X-BeenThere: dev@dpdk.org
X-Mailman-Version: 2.1.29
Precedence: list
List-Id: DPDK patches and discussions <dev.dpdk.org>
List-Unsubscribe: <https://mails.dpdk.org/options/dev>,
 <mailto:dev-request@dpdk.org?subject=unsubscribe>
List-Archive: <http://mails.dpdk.org/archives/dev/>
List-Post: <mailto:dev@dpdk.org>
List-Help: <mailto:dev-request@dpdk.org?subject=help>
List-Subscribe: <https://mails.dpdk.org/listinfo/dev>,
 <mailto:dev-request@dpdk.org?subject=subscribe>
Errors-To: dev-bounces@dpdk.org
Sender: "dev" <dev-bounces@dpdk.org>

> Subject: Re: [dpdk-dev] [PATCH v5 9/9] app/testpmd: enable building
> testpmd on Windows
>=20
> External email: Use caution opening links or attachments
>=20
>=20
> > Subject: Re: [dpdk-dev] [PATCH v5 9/9] app/testpmd: enable building
> > testpmd on Windows
> >
> > External email: Use caution opening links or attachments
> >
> >
> > 18/04/2021 19:21, Tal Shnaiderman:
> > > Building testpmd results in 2 warnings in clang:
> > >
> > > ../app/test-pmd/config.c:4254:1: warning: unused function
> > > 'print_fdir_mask' [-Wunused-function] print_fdir_mask(struct
> > > rte_eth_fdir_masks *mask) ^
> > > ../app/test-pmd/config.c:4289:1: warning: unused function
> > > 'print_fdir_flex_payload' [-Wunused-function]
> > > print_fdir_flex_payload(struct rte_eth_fdir_flex_conf *flex_conf,
> > > uint32_t num) ^
> > > 2 warnings generated.
> >
> > Why all tests are passing in the CI?
> > I feel there is something wrong. We must test with -werror.
>=20
> I know that the UNH Windows CI runs with -werror however the test didn't
> run on clang yet [1].
> This patch passed Intel compilation test on Windows, however I don't know=
 if
> -werror is used there [2].
>=20
> [1] - https://lab.dpdk.org/results/dashboard/patchsets/16593/
> [2] - http://mails.dpdk.org/archives/test-report/2021-April/188796.html

Update: the UNH test run a few minutes ago and as expected, failed with the=
 compilation warnings.
For some reason however the test appears as 'passed' in patchwork.